Formative evaluation of the Thinktwice school-based lifeskills programme for the prevention of child sexual abuse
Child sexual abuse is a prevalent problem in South Africa. There are reports of child sexual abuse of very young children in the media on an almost daily basis. South African Police Services reports show that children are victims in almost 50 of all reported cases of indecent assault and rape. It …
